Understanding Geo-Restrictions and Licensing Agreements
Amazon Prime, like other streaming services, operates under strict geo-restrictions and licensing agreements. These restrictions are in place due to copyright laws and distribution rights that vary by country. Geo-restrictions refer to the practice of limiting access to online content based on the user’s geographical location. This means that certain content available on Amazon Prime in one country may not be available in another due to differences in licensing agreements.
Licensing Agreements Explained
Licensing agreements are contracts between content providers (such as movie studios or television networks) and streaming services (like Amazon Prime). These agreements dictate which content can be streamed in specific territories. For instance, a movie studio might grant Amazon Prime the rights to stream a particular movie in the United States but not in Europe. This is why the content library on Amazon Prime varies significantly from one country to another.

Workarounds for Watching Amazon Prime Abroad
While Amazon Prime’s terms of service prohibit the use of VPNs (Virtual Private Networks) or proxies to circumvent geo-restrictions, many users find ways to access their content library from abroad. VPNs can mask a user’s IP address, making it appear as though they are accessing the internet from a different location. This can potentially allow users to access Amazon Prime content that is not available in their current location.
Using VPNs: Risks and Considerations
Using a VPN to watch Amazon Prime in another country comes with risks. Amazon actively works to block VPN traffic, and if detected, users might face account restrictions or termination. Furthermore, not all VPNs are created equal; some may offer better performance, security, and compatibility with streaming services than others. It’s essential to research and choose a reputable VPN provider that can effectively bypass geo-restrictions without compromising speed or security.

Amazon’s Official Stance and Alternatives
Amazon’s official stance is clear: it does not support the use of VPNs or other methods to bypass geo-restrictions. However, the company does offer some alternatives for accessing content while abroad. For example, users can download certain titles for offline viewing before traveling, allowing them to access content without needing to stream it.
Downloadable Content
The ability to download content for offline viewing is a significant advantage of Amazon Prime. This feature allows subscribers to access their favorite shows and movies even without an internet connection, making it ideal for travelers. However, not all content is available for download, and the selection varies by country.
Regional Amazon Prime Services
Another approach is to subscribe to the local Amazon Prime service in the country you are visiting or residing in. Each region’s Amazon Prime offers a unique content library tailored to local tastes and licensing agreements. While this might require managing multiple subscriptions, it provides a legal and straightforward way to access a wide range of content without violating Amazon’s terms of service.

Can I watch Amazon Prime content on multiple devices at the same time?
Yes, Amazon Prime allows users to watch content on multiple devices at the same time, but there are some limitations. The number of devices that can be used to watch Amazon Prime content at the same time depends on the type of content being watched. For example, users can watch up to three different titles at the same time on different devices, but only two devices can be used to watch the same title at the same time. This means that if you’re watching a movie on your TV, you can also watch a different movie on your tablet or smartphone, but you can’t watch the same movie on both devices at the same time.

Can I download Amazon Prime content for offline viewing across borders?
Yes, Amazon Prime allows users to download certain content for offline viewing, but there are some limitations. The availability of downloadable content varies depending on the region and the type of content. For example, some movies and TV shows may be available for download in the US, but not in other countries. Additionally, downloadable content is only available on certain devices, such as smartphones and tablets, and not on all devices that support Amazon Prime.
To download Amazon Prime content for offline viewing, you’ll need to use the Amazon Prime app on a compatible device. You can browse the available downloadable content by going to the Amazon Prime app and looking for the “Download” option. Once you’ve downloaded the content, you can watch it offline without an internet connection. However, be aware that downloadable content is only available for a limited time, and you may need to reconnect to the internet to renew your download or access additional content. Additionally, some content may not be available for download due to licensing agreements or other restrictions, so it’s essential to check the availability of downloadable content before attempting to download it.
